This is a visual (rather than a purely mathematical) guide to the world of fractals. You won’t find many equations or algorithms but you will encounter hundreds of pictures, most of them stunning – the few that aren’t turn out to be thumbnails giving constructional details, so it’s all good stuff.This book would find a very happy home on the shelf of an advanced mathematics student who already has the dry mathematical theory texts but who is looking for a visual feast for the eyes, or indeed anyone who has a passing interest in fractal design. As someone who is interested in maths and geometry but having not studied maths to a very high level, I found this book very clear, informative and interesting. Baird doesn't go deep into mathematical theory, but different sets and variations of fractals are shown in clear black and white diagrams, often with thumbnails showing closer detail of an area of the fractal. Two hundred and fifty diagrams illustrate some of the standard fractal types and their variations, with explanatory thumbnails giving constructional details. With an emphasis on illustration rather than mathematics, Alt.Fractals is a fascinating browsing experience for the newcomer, a key resource for anyone interested in fractal designs, and an essential bookshelf reference for the expert.
